March 2014 Release - Title: Movements In Touch For Parent-Child Pairs Author: Gilad Naaman Perry Genre: Health RRP: £10.99 ISBN: 9781849636063 Book Synopsis: The book, MOVEMENTS IN TOUCH FOR PARENT-CHILD PAIRS, provides parents with a wide assortment of communicative techniques and bonding opportunities with their infants that shape their development (curiosity, learning, experiences and pleasure), self-esteem and trust, through the use of the two basic survival elements - movement and touch. The experience of natural activity between parent and baby through movement and touch sets a relaxed atmosphere that encourages a baby-parent relationship rich in giving and receiving while releasing body tension at the same time. MOVEMENTS IN TOUCH FOR PARENT-CHILD PAIRS deals with three areas: the first and primary parent-baby bonding; the second is personal well-being through individual activity; while the third area explores intimacy and relationships, to form a deeper connection between partners. Gilad Naaman Perry holds a Master of Education (M.Ed.) from the University of Leeds and specializes in communication through touch and movement as it relates to body and spirit. He lectures on topics of communication and the significant roles of touch and movement in the processes of forming bonds with others. Naamans interest in the subject of body relaxation took on a new meaning during his many years of child rearing. Based on his studies and experience Naaman designed movements that incorporate body relaxation founded on the positive releasing properties of touch.
